黑狐家游戏

数据仓库视频教程,数据仓库视频

欧气 5 0

数据仓库视频教程:构建高效数据处理体系

一、引言

在当今数字化时代,数据已成为企业的重要资产,如何有效地管理和利用这些数据,以支持决策制定和业务发展,成为了企业面临的重要挑战,数据仓库作为一种用于数据分析和决策支持的技术,能够帮助企业整合和管理来自多个数据源的数据,提供高效的数据处理和分析能力,本视频教程将介绍数据仓库的基本概念、架构和关键技术,帮助您了解如何构建和使用数据仓库。

二、数据仓库的基本概念

(一)数据仓库的定义

数据仓库是一个面向主题的、集成的、相对稳定的、反映历史变化的数据集合,用于支持管理决策,它是对多个数据源的数据进行整合和处理,以提供统一的数据视图和分析能力。

(二)数据仓库的特点

1、面向主题:数据仓库的数据是围绕特定的主题进行组织的,例如客户、产品、销售等。

2、集成:数据仓库的数据来自多个数据源,需要进行整合和清洗,以确保数据的一致性和准确性。

3、相对稳定:数据仓库中的数据是历史数据的积累,通常不会频繁修改。

4、反映历史变化:数据仓库能够记录数据的变化历史,以便进行数据分析和趋势预测。

三、数据仓库的架构

(一)数据仓库的架构模型

数据仓库的架构模型通常包括数据源、数据存储、数据处理和数据分析四个部分。

1、数据源:数据源是数据仓库的数据来源,包括关系型数据库、文件系统、XML 文档等。

2、数据存储:数据存储是数据仓库的数据存储介质,通常采用关系型数据库或数据仓库产品。

3、数据处理:数据处理是对数据源的数据进行整合、清洗和转换的过程,以确保数据的一致性和准确性。

4、数据分析:数据分析是对数据仓库中的数据进行分析和挖掘的过程,以支持决策制定和业务发展。

(二)数据仓库的分层架构

数据仓库的分层架构通常包括数据源层、数据存储层、数据处理层和数据分析层四个部分。

1、数据源层:数据源层是数据仓库的数据来源,包括关系型数据库、文件系统、XML 文档等。

2、数据存储层:数据存储层是数据仓库的数据存储介质,通常采用关系型数据库或数据仓库产品。

3、数据处理层:数据处理层是对数据源的数据进行整合、清洗和转换的过程,以确保数据的一致性和准确性。

4、数据分析层:数据分析层是对数据仓库中的数据进行分析和挖掘的过程,以支持决策制定和业务发展。

四、数据仓库的关键技术

(一)数据建模

数据建模是数据仓库设计的核心,它决定了数据仓库的结构和数据的组织方式,数据建模的方法包括实体关系模型(ER 模型)、维度模型和星型模型等。

(二)数据清洗

数据清洗是对数据源中的数据进行清理和纠正的过程,以确保数据的一致性和准确性,数据清洗的方法包括数据过滤、数据转换、数据填充和数据验证等。

(三)数据存储

数据存储是数据仓库的数据存储介质,通常采用关系型数据库或数据仓库产品,数据存储的方式包括表存储、列存储和混合存储等。

(四)数据处理

数据处理是对数据源的数据进行整合、清洗和转换的过程,以确保数据的一致性和准确性,数据处理的方法包括 ETL(Extract, Transform, Load)工具、数据仓库引擎和分布式计算框架等。

(五)数据分析

数据分析是对数据仓库中的数据进行分析和挖掘的过程,以支持决策制定和业务发展,数据分析的方法包括数据挖掘、机器学习、统计分析和可视化分析等。

五、数据仓库的应用场景

(一)企业决策支持

数据仓库能够提供统一的数据视图和分析能力,帮助企业管理层做出更加科学和准确的决策。

(二)市场营销

数据仓库能够帮助企业了解客户需求和行为,制定更加有效的市场营销策略。

(三)风险管理

数据仓库能够帮助企业监控和管理风险,及时发现和解决潜在的风险问题。

(四)财务分析

数据仓库能够帮助企业进行财务分析和预算管理,提高财务管理的效率和准确性。

六、结论

数据仓库作为一种用于数据分析和决策支持的技术,能够帮助企业整合和管理来自多个数据源的数据,提供高效的数据处理和分析能力,本视频教程介绍了数据仓库的基本概念、架构和关键技术,帮助您了解如何构建和使用数据仓库,通过学习本教程,您将能够掌握数据仓库的基本原理和方法,为企业的数据分析和决策支持提供有力的支持。

标签: #数据仓库 #视频教程 #视频 #学习资源

黑狐家游戏
  • 评论列表

留言评论